 20# Tutorial: Azure Active Directory integration with Kindling
 21
 22The objective of this tutorial is to show you how to integrate Kindling with Azure Active Directory (Azure AD).  
 23Integrating Kindling with Azure AD provides you with the following benefits: 
 24
 25- You can control in Azure AD who has access to Kindling 
 26- You can enable your users to automatically get signed-on to Kindling (Single Sign-On) with their Azure AD accounts
 27- You can manage your accounts in one central location - the Azure classic portal 
 28

 88##  Configuring and testing Azure AD single sign-on
 89The objective of this section is to show you how to configure and test Azure AD single sign-on with Kindling based on a test user called "Britta Simon".
 90
 91For single sign-on to work, Azure AD needs to know what the counterpart user in Kindling to an user in Azure AD is. In other words, a link relationship between an Azure AD user and the related user in Kindling needs to be established.  
 92This link relationship is established by assigning the value of the **user name** in Azure AD as the value of the **Username** in Kindling.
 93

102### Configuring Azure AD Single Sign-On
103
104The objective of this section is to enable Azure AD single sign-on in the Azure classic portal and to configure single sign-on in your Kindling application. As part of this procedure, you are required to create a base-64 encoded certificate file. If you are not familiar with this procedure, see [How to convert a binary certificate into a text file](http://youtu.be/PlgrzUZ-Y1o).
105
106To configure single sign-on for Kindling, you need a registered domain. If you don't have a registered domain yet, contact your Kindling support team via [support@kindlingapp.com](mailto:support@kindlingapp.com).  
107
108
109
110**To configure Azure AD single sign-on with Kindling, perform the following steps:**
111
1121. In the Azure classic portal, on the **Kindling** application integration page, click **Configure single sign-on** to open the **Configure Single Sign-On**  dialog.
113
114	![Configure Single Sign-On][6] 
115
1162. On the **How would you like users to sign on to Kindling** page, select **Azure AD Single Sign-On**, and then click **Next**.
117
118	![Configure Single Sign-On](./media/active-directory-saas-kindling-tutorial/tutorial_kindling_03.png) 
119
1203. On the **Configure App Settings** dialog page, perform the following steps:
121
122	![Configure Single Sign-On](./media/active-directory-saas-kindling-tutorial/tutorial_kindling_04.png) 
123
124
125    a. In the **Sign On URL** textbox, type the URL used by your users to sign-on to your Kindling application  using the following pattern: `https://<company name>.kindlingapp.com/`
126
127    b. Contact yout Kindling support team via [support@kindlingapp.com](mailto:support@kindlingapp.com) to get the **Issuer** and the **Reply URL** value.   
128
129    c. In the **Issuer** textbox, type your Issuer URL.
130
131    d. In the **Reply URL** textbox, type your Reply URL.   
132 
133    e. Click **Next**.
134 
135 
1364. On the **Configure single sign-on at Kindling** page, perform the following steps:
137
138	![Configure Single Sign-On](./media/active-directory-saas-kindling-tutorial/tutorial_kindling_05.png) 
139
140    a. Click **Download certificate**, and then save the file on your computer.
141
142    b. Click **Next**.
143
144
145
1461. Contact your Kindling support team via [support@kindlingapp.com](mailto:support@kindlingapp.com) and provide them with the following:
147
148	- The downloaded certificate
149	- The **Issuer URL** value that maps to Kindling's **Entity ID**
150	- The **Single Sign-On Service URL** that maps to Kindling's **SSO Sign On URL** 
151	- The **Single Sign-Out Service URL** that maps to Kindling's **SSO Sign Out URL**. 
152
1536. In the Azure classic portal, select the single sign-on configuration confirmation, and then click **Next**. 
154
155	![Azure AD Single Sign-On][10]
156
1577. On the **Single sign-on confirmation** page, click **Complete**.  
158	
159	![Azure AD Single Sign-On][11]

222### Creating a Kindling test user
223
224The objective of this section is to create a user called Britta Simon in Kindling.
225Kindling supports just-in-time provisioning. You have already enabled it in [Configuring Azure AD Single Sign-On](#configuring-azure-ad-single-single-sign-on).
226
227There is no action item for you in this section.
